Company Overview - Source Photonics Holdings (Cayman) Limited was established on November 17, 2010, in the Cayman Islands with a registered capital of $50,000 [1] - The company is primarily engaged in the research, development, production, and sales of optical chips, optical components, and optical modules, mainly used in data centers and telecommunications [1] Financial Reporting Basis - The financial statements are prepared in accordance with the accounting standards issued by the Ministry of Finance, based on the going concern principle [1] - The accounting period follows the calendar year, from January 1 to December 31, with the current reporting period defined as the first quarter of 2025 [1] Accounting Policies - The company capitalizes R&D expenses and recognizes revenue based on specific conditions tailored to its operational characteristics [1] - Significant accounting policies include the treatment of construction in progress, investment activities, and capitalized R&D projects, with a threshold of RMB 5 million for materiality [1] Consolidation and Mergers - For mergers under common control, the assets and liabilities of the acquired entity are measured at their book value on the merger date [2] - Non-common control mergers recognize the acquisition cost at fair value, with any excess over the identifiable net assets recognized as goodwill [2] Financial Instruments - Financial assets are classified at initial recognition based on the business model and cash flow characteristics, including those measured at amortized cost and fair value [9][10] - The company assesses expected credit losses based on historical data, current conditions, and forecasts of future economic conditions [18][19] Currency and Foreign Operations - The company operates in multiple currencies, with the reporting currency being USD, while subsidiaries may use RMB or TWD based on their operational environments [1] - Foreign currency transactions are translated at the exchange rate on the transaction date, with monetary items at the balance sheet date rate [7][8] Inventory Management - Inventory is classified into raw materials, work in progress, and finished goods, with valuation based on actual cost [29] - The company uses a perpetual inventory system and assesses inventory for impairment when the net realizable value is lower than cost [30] Long-term Investments - Long-term equity investments are accounted for using the cost method for subsidiaries and the equity method for associates and joint ventures [31] - The initial investment cost for mergers is based on the book value of the acquired entity's net assets or the fair value of consideration paid [31]
